girth — full definition

  1. noun The measurement around something; its circumference.
  2. noun A strap that goes under a horse's belly to hold a saddle in place.

mesh — full definition

  1. noun Material made of crossed strands with regular small gaps between them, like a net or screen.
  2. noun A network in which every device connects to several others rather than to one central hub.
  3. verb To fit together or work well as a combined unit; to mesh with something.
